Unfortunately the PVP equipment is much more expensive to operate.
The equipment is usually owned only by hospitals. Countries with
National Health service are not adoping it because of the expensive
equipment. Still not available in Canada and appears to be minimal in
UK. Some countries are beginning to realize that they may save in the
the long run with shorter hospital stays (Patient comfort is not an
issue).
